- Gift MumbaApr 17, 2025 · 3 months agoYes, Binance offers a feature called 'Transaction History' that allows users to track and view incoming transfers. By accessing the 'Transaction History' section on the Binance platform, users can see a detailed record of all their incoming transfers, including the sender's information, transaction amount, and timestamp. This feature provides transparency and enables users to keep track of their funds effectively.
